Theory:
A smart home is a home equipped with advanced automation and communication technologies that
enable residents to control and monitor various home appliances and systems remotely. These
technologies include the Internet of Things (IoT), which refers to the connection of physical
devices to the internet and the exchange of data between them.
Smart home devices are typically connected to the internet via Wi-Fi or Bluetooth, allowing the
homeowner to control and monitor them remotely through a mobile app or a voice-activated
assistant. Examples of smart home devices include smart thermostats, smart lights, smart locks,
smart cameras, and smart appliances.
